I used soft materials like charcoal, pastels and colored pencils. This work is built on contrasts. The contrast is tactile and visual as well as emotional. The strength of the stately body of a dark-skinned man is drowned in the tenderness and weightlessness of colored petals, which will disappear in a moment.
The beauty of the human body is the strongest magnet that evokes many feelings and emotions. Nudity can be defenseless and have a powerful force at the same time. The smoothness of gentle curves, strong honed shapes, color, angle of inclination cause a storm of conscious and uncontrollable impulses. The scent of thought is invisible...

Natalya Pravda is a contemporary Ukrainian artist whose creative journey is marked by a relentless exploration of diverse techniques and source materials. Her artistic vision encompasses a wide spectrum of imagery, ranging from the abstract to the figurative, often interwoven with subtle or explicit references. Despite the potential for interpretation, Natalya advocates for an open-ended approach to experiencing her art, emphasizing the boundless nature of human perception.
Central to Natalya's practice is a profound engagement with the purity of color and its dynamic interplay with the canvas. Through her works, she seeks to articulate moments of quiet revelation, inviting viewers into a realm where meaning unfolds organically.
For Natalya, the act of creation transcends mere craftsmanship; it is a process of nurturing and facilitating emergence. Rather than constructing her pieces methodically, she fosters an environment where spontaneity reigns, allowing the artwork to evolve autonomously.
Drawing inspiration from the inherent qualities of her chosen materials, Natalya's artistic journey is characterized by continual discovery. Each encounter with pigment and canvas becomes a voyage into uncharted territory, yielding unexpected revelations and enriching her practice.
The essence of Natalya's creative process lies in embracing uncertainty and relinquishing the impulse for formulaic repetition. Instead, she embraces improvisation as a catalyst for innovation, tempered by the wisdom gained through cumulative experience.
In Natalya's world, creativity thrives on the element of surprise, defying attempts at prediction or control. It is a dynamic interplay between intuition and action, where readiness to seize the moment is paramount.
Through her art, Natalya Pravda invites audiences to embark on a journey of exploration, where the boundaries between creator and creation blur, and the joy of discovery awaits at every turn.
